Gleeson, Phillip Thomas

JurisdictionAustralia — New South Wales
BodyOffice of the Legal Services Commissioner (NSW) (OLSC)
Professionsolicitor — Moama Law
Date28-Oct-2021
HearingCouncil of the Law Society of New South Wales

Allegation / charges

<p>1. Discourtesy:</p><p>a. That the Respondent Solicitor failed on 4 occasions over nearly 2 years to either appear for his client himself, or arrange appropriate representation.</p><p>b. The Respondent Solicitor failed to provide a reasonable explanation for the above, despite being requested by the Court to do so;</p><p>c. The Respondent Solicitor’s conduct unnecessarily delayed the resolution of the proceedings;</p><p>d. The Respondent Solicitor reinstated himself on the record shortly after the Court had ordered his client to remove him, and then proceeded again to not appear or arrange alternative representation for his client.</p> — Unsatisfactory Professional Conduct
